AR体感游戏开发正成为数字娱乐领域的重要发展方向,尤其在移动设备普及与空间计算技术不断成熟的背景下,越来越多开发者开始关注如何将现实环境与虚拟内容深度融合。这类游戏不仅依赖于精准的空间定位与实时交互能力,更需要在视觉表现、操作反馈和用户体验之间取得平衡。对于初创团队或独立开发者而言,从零开始构建一个完整的AR体感游戏项目,往往面临技术门槛高、资源调配难、流程不清晰等挑战。因此,掌握一套系统化、可落地的开发流程,是提升项目成功率的关键。
核心概念与技术基础梳理
首先需要明确的是,AR体感游戏并非简单的图像叠加,而是基于真实世界的空间感知与用户动作捕捉实现的动态交互体验。其核心技术主要包括SLAM(即时定位与地图构建)、深度感知、手势识别以及3D空间渲染。目前主流平台如Apple的ARKit与Google的ARCore已提供相对成熟的底层支持,开发者可通过这些框架快速搭建基础环境。同时,Unity作为跨平台开发引擎,在图形处理能力和生态整合方面具备显著优势,被广泛应用于AR体感游戏的开发实践中。理解这些基础组件的工作原理,有助于在后续开发中做出合理的技术选型。
需求分析与原型设计阶段
在正式编码前,清晰的需求定义至关重要。建议团队采用“用户旅程图”方式,模拟玩家从启动应用到完成一次完整游戏体验的全过程,识别关键交互节点与潜在痛点。例如,是否需要多人协同?场景是否依赖特定物理空间?动作响应延迟是否可接受?这些问题的答案将直接影响后续的交互逻辑设计与性能优化策略。原型设计阶段推荐使用低保真原型工具(如Figma或Adobe XD)快速验证玩法可行性,避免过早投入大量代码资源。

3D建模与空间定位实现
高质量的3D模型是提升沉浸感的基础。建议优先选用轻量化模型格式(如glTF),并配合LOD(细节层次)技术控制资源占用。在空间定位方面,应充分利用设备自带的摄像头与传感器数据,结合ARKit/ARCore提供的平面检测功能,实现稳定且精准的虚拟物体锚定。特别需要注意的是,不同设备间的硬件差异可能导致定位漂移,因此需在多种机型上进行充分测试,并设置合理的容错机制。
交互逻辑与用户体验优化
交互设计是决定游戏“好不好玩”的核心。常见的体感交互包括手势识别、身体姿态追踪、语音指令等。在实现过程中,应避免过度依赖复杂算法带来的高延迟,优先考虑简洁、直观的操作路径。例如,通过手势“挥手”触发攻击动作,比要求精确手势轨迹更容易被用户掌握。此外,反馈机制同样重要——视觉提示、音效变化与轻微震动都能有效增强用户的参与感。性能方面,需持续监控帧率与内存占用,确保在低端设备上也能流畅运行。
跨平台适配与发布准备
随着用户设备多样化,跨平台兼容性已成为不可忽视的环节。若目标市场覆盖iOS与Android双端,建议采用Unity+ARKit/ARCore双引擎架构,通过统一代码库降低维护成本。同时,注意各平台对权限申请、后台运行、电池消耗等方面的限制,提前做好合规性调整。发布前还需完成应用商店审核所需的材料准备,包括截图、说明文案、隐私政策等,并预留足够时间应对可能的返工。
本地化开发团队的优势与潜力
以合肥为例,近年来在人工智能、智能制造与数字经济领域的布局逐步深化,形成了较为完善的科技产业生态。本地高校资源丰富,为游戏开发提供了稳定的人才供给;同时,政府对高新技术企业的扶持政策也降低了初期运营成本。对于希望控制预算又追求质量的中小型团队而言,组建本地化开发小组不仅能缩短沟通周期,还能更好地对接区域内的技术支持与合作机会。
流程规范化带来的长期价值
当一套标准化的开发流程被建立并持续优化后,项目的可复制性与迭代效率将大幅提升。团队不再依赖个人经验,而是依靠文档、模板与自动化工具推进工作。这不仅有助于减少人为失误,也为未来拓展新项目或引入外部投资打下坚实基础。更重要的是,规范流程能显著缩短从概念到上线的时间周期,让产品更快触达目标用户,抢占市场先机。
我们专注于AR体感游戏开发全流程服务,涵盖需求分析、技术选型、原型设计、开发实现与上线支持,依托成熟的技术体系与本地化协作网络,助力开发者高效完成项目落地,17723342546
— THE END —
服务介绍
联系电话:17723342546(微信同号)